Official-looking pictures of the Moto Buds and Buds+ earbuds have just popped up online, which suggests Motorola plans to make these official very soon. Unfortunately, no other details about the earbuds have been leaked, so the pictures are all we have at the moment. One of differences between the Buds and Buds+ models seem to be the fact that the latter’s sound is powered by Bose, at least according to the case.
We also know codenames for the Moto Buds and Buds+ are Guitar and Flute, but that’s probably not that important
